What would happen if the leaves of a money plant is coated with oil?

Open in App
Solution

If the leaves of a money plant are coated with oil, then stomata present on the surface of the leaf will get blocked. Transpiration which takes place through stomata would be affected adversely. Gaseous exchange also takes place through stomata
